As the Australian Open 2026 unfolds, veteran Lleyton Hewitt shares guidance for his son Cruz, while rising star Maya Joint sets ambitious goals. This recap examines their journeys and aspirations in the world of tennis.
Lleyton Hewitt, drawing from his illustrious career, emphasizes the importance of focusing on personal improvement for his son Cruz. Meanwhile, 19-year-old Maya Joint is turning heads as Australia's leading female tennis player. Joint, who was born in Michigan but represents Australia, has set her sights on significant milestones, including reaching the third round of a Grand Slam and winning a WTA 500 event. Her determination to compete at the highest levels marks an exciting chapter for Australian tennis.
Cruz Hewitt's recent performance in the Australian Open qualifying round, where he faced a tough opponent in Michael Zheng, underscores the competitive nature of the sport. Despite the setback, his participation provides valuable experience and learning opportunities. Storm Hunter's return from injury adds another compelling storyline to the tournament, highlighting the resilience and dedication required to overcome challenges in professional tennis.
